what kinds of space and matter can light travel through

Respuesta :

xim3na xim3na
  • 04-05-2020

Answer:

Light travels as a wave. But unlike sound waves or water waves, it does not need any matter or material to carry its energy along. This means that light can travel through a vacuum—a completely airless space. (Sound, on the other hand, must travel through a solid, a liquid, or a gas.)
